Physical properties
Hardness: 7 on the Mohs scale, Color: Grey with subtle banding, Luster: Vitreous to greasy, Crystal structure: Trigonal (microcrystalline quartz grains), Cleavage: None (fractures conchoidally), Specific gravity: 2.65
Formation & geological history
Formed through the metamorphism of quartz-rich sandstone under high heat and pressure, typically in tectonic mountain-building events over millions of years
Uses & applications
Used in landscaping, construction aggregate, decorative stones, and road surfacing
Geological facts
Quartzite is extremely resistant to weathering and chemical breakdown, which is why it often survives long transport in rivers and oceans to become smooth, rounded pebbles
Field identification & locations
Can be identified in the field by its high hardness (scratches glass easily), lack of reaction to acid, and sugary texture visible on broken surfaces; commonly found in riverbeds, beaches, and glacial deposits
